Mandatory masks and Lip Reading

In Hamilton Council’s debate on the mandatory face mask bylaw, the question was raised about what accommodation can be made for hearing impaired persons who rely on lip-reading. A possible answer comes from the UK where Danny Hughes is a paramedic, an ex RAF Medic who is Interested in Critical Care & Clinical Education
